Please pray for the repose of James Foley's soul. Jim is the American reporter who was kidnapped while reporting in Syria almost two years ago. Today the news is reporting that ISIS beheaded him and posted the video of the killing on the internet.

Also, please pray for his family, who is suffering so terribly right now. His parents are members of my parish. His mom released this statement just a short while ago:

"We have never been prouder of our son Jim. He gave his life trying to expose the world to the suffering of the Syrian people."

"We implore the kidnappers to spare the lives of the remaining hostages. Like Jim, they are innocents. They have no control over American government policy in Iraq, Syria or anywhere in the world.

"We thank Jim for all the joy he gave us. He was an extraordinary son, brother, journalist and person. Please respect our privacy in the days ahead as we mourn and cherish Jim."
